Abstract

In this paper, elucidation is given on the applications of radioisotopes to the petroleum industry, citing some applications chiefly in the United States.They are divided into two groups, applications as tracers and radiation sources.As the former, the author explains the application to the chemical analysis, researches on the reaction mechanisms and transmission of materials (distillation, mixing, stirring, wear, etc.) And the latter is the fixed radiation sources (radiograph, thickness gauge, level gauge, hydrometer), movable radiation sources (flow of fluid in pipe, leak test of pipe, etc.) and radiation energy sources.
